Rome Odunze is being drafted at ADP 61.7 (WR27) and JJ Zachariason identifies him as a third-year breakout candidate and clear buy opportunity. Before teammate Luther Burden injured his groin in training camp, Odunze was going over 20 picks later in drafts. With DJ Moore traded to Buffalo, 85 targets are freed up. In Weeks 1-8 before his midseason foot injury, Odunze ranked as WR11 in fantasy points per game (15.5) and averaged a 25% target share—the type of ceiling fantasy managers should target. He remains the cheaper option compared to teammates including tight end Colston Loveland.
